Fairway Oaks stands at 17 Village Way in Brockton, MA. This low-rise building has one story and features a total of 8 condo units. Built in 1977, this well-maintained property reflects a cozy community vibe. The building’s structure blends into its surroundings while providing easy access to local amenities. Each condo unit has 1 bedroom, with sizes ranging from 710 to 1,010 square feet. Starting prices for these units are around $94,900. The combination of unit sizes makes it suitable for various living situations. Residents enjoy a mix of space and comfort in their homes. Fairway Oaks includes some attractive amenities. There is a swimming pool for relaxation and tennis courts for active lifestyles. Hot water service enhances daily living and public transport options are nearby. These features promote a well-rounded lifestyle for everyone. Nearby dining options include Caos Kitchen Inc and DW Grill, offering different choices for meals. For grocery shopping, Oak Street Convenience Store provides quick access to daily needs. The building's location connects easily to local roads and key intersections, simplifying travel in the area. The closest water body is the Neponset River, which adds to the neighborhood's charm. This building makes a great spot for those seeking a small community feel within Brockton.
